Excellent Diving sites. Promising tourist attractions. Commendable palm-lined beaches. These are what Talikud Island can offer to its visitors. Talikud Island is located in the South-West area of the Samal Island. It is about 1 hour away from the Sta. Ana wharf, Davao City and you can reach this Island via a boat.

We went to three different parts of the Island. With the help of this boat, we have explored different excellent diving spots in Talikud Island.



First stop: Angel’s cove


 
Angel’s cove has healthy coral reefs and I can say this is a commendable diving spot. 



The water is very clear that you can just snorkel to see the underwater living species.

Second Stop: Babu Santa


 
Clean and reserved Island. This is where we stayed for lunch. Despite the fact that the island is a little bit crowded, cleanliness is their first priority here.

 
Third Stop: The west part of Angel’s Cove



For our third and final stop, we went to this part of the angel’s cove. This area is deeper than the other islands we visited. And if it is deeper, you can even see more unique sea creatures and an ultimate island hopping experience.
